The mission of the South Carolina Department of Corrections is: Safety--we will protect the public, our employees, and our inmates. Service--we will provide rehabilitation and self-improvement opportunities for inmates. Stewardship--we will promote professional excellence, fiscal responsibility, and self-sufficiency.

Learn About SCDC

The South Carolina Department of Corrections protects the citizens by confining offenders in controlled facilities and by providing rehabilitative, self-improvement opportunities to prepare inmates for their re-integration into society.

The employees of the South Carolina Department of Corrections will be seen as a progressive force that works together to ensure the safety of each other, to improve the lives and meet legitimate needs of the inmates, and prepare them for re-entry into society.
